def _create_schema(self):
|
|
"""Create Cassandra schema for triple storage."""
|
|
# Create keyspace
|
|
self.session.execute(f"""
|
|
CREATE KEYSPACE IF NOT EXISTS {self.keyspace}
|
|
WITH replication = {{'class': 'SimpleStrategy', 'replication_factor': 1}}
|
|
""")
|
|
|
|
# Create triples table optimized for SPARQL queries
|
|
self.session.execute(f"""
|
|
CREATE TABLE IF NOT EXISTS {self.triple_table} (
|
|
subject text,
|
|
predicate text,
|
|
object text,
|
|
object_datatype text,
|
|
object_language text,
|
|
is_literal boolean,
|
|
graph_id text,
|
|
PRIMARY KEY ((subject), predicate, object)
|
|
)
|
|
""")
|
|
|
|
# Create indexes for efficient querying
|
|
self.session.execute(f"""
|
|
CREATE INDEX IF NOT EXISTS ON {self.triple_table} (predicate)
|
|
""")
|
|
self.session.execute(f"""
|
|
CREATE INDEX IF NOT EXISTS ON {self.triple_table} (object)
|
|
""")
|
|
|
|
# Metadata table for graph information
|
|
self.session.execute(f"""
|
|
CREATE TABLE IF NOT EXISTS {self.metadata_table} (
|
|
graph_id text PRIMARY KEY,
|
|
created timestamp,
|
|
modified timestamp,
|
|
triple_count counter
|
|
)
|
|
""")

def _pattern_to_cql(self, subject, predicate, object_val) -> List[Tuple[str, List]]:
|
|
"""Convert triple pattern to CQL queries.
|
|
|
|
Args:
|
|
subject: Subject node or None
|
|
predicate: Predicate node or None
|
|
object_val: Object node or None
|
|
|
|
Returns:
|
|
List of (CQL query, parameters) tuples
|
|
"""
|
|
queries = []
|
|
|
|
# Convert None to wildcard, nodes to strings
|
|
s_str = str(subject) if subject else None
|
|
p_str = str(predicate) if predicate else None
|
|
o_str = str(object_val) if object_val else None
|
|
|
|
if s_str and p_str and o_str:
|
|
# Specific triple lookup
|
|
cql = f"SELECT * FROM {self.triple_table} WHERE subject = ? AND predicate = ? AND object = ?"
|
|
queries.append((cql, [s_str, p_str, o_str]))
|
|
|
|
elif s_str and p_str:
|
|
# Subject and predicate known
|
|
cql = f"SELECT * FROM {self.triple_table} WHERE subject = ? AND predicate = ?"
|
|
queries.append((cql, [s_str, p_str]))
|
|
|
|
elif s_str:
|
|
# Subject known
|
|
cql = f"SELECT * FROM {self.triple_table} WHERE subject = ?"
|
|
queries.append((cql, [s_str]))
|
|
|
|
elif p_str:
|
|
# Predicate known (requires index scan)
|
|
cql = f"SELECT * FROM {self.triple_table} WHERE predicate = ? ALLOW FILTERING"
|
|
queries.append((cql, [p_str]))
|
|
|
|
elif o_str:
|
|
# Object known (requires index scan)
|
|
cql = f"SELECT * FROM {self.triple_table} WHERE object = ? ALLOW FILTERING"
|
|
queries.append((cql, [o_str]))
|
|
|
|
else:
|
|
# Full scan (should be avoided in production)
|
|
cql = f"SELECT * FROM {self.triple_table}"
|
|
queries.append((cql, []))
|
|
|
|
return queries
